The Office of the Federal Public Defender for the District of Alaska provides legal representation throughout the State of Alaska to people charged with federal crimes. In addition to the direct representation of appointed clients in federal trial courts, we provide legal services for clients at the appellate and post-conviction “habeas” levels. Our office also administers the appointment and routine training of Criminal Justice Act panel attorneys in the District of Alaska to provide further support of indigent rights. We strive for a client centered collaborative approach, embracing open communication among all staff, exploring new ideas and approaches, and fostering a strong work ethic.
Alaska - “The Great Land” - has an area of 663,300 square miles. It is the largest geographical federal judicial district in the United States and covers an area three times the size of Texas. We have typical federal cases like guns, drugs, fraud, cybercrime, and child pornography, but we also have wildlife and environmental prosecutions under the Lacey Act, the Clean Air Act, and a host of environmental protection laws.
Our office is in Anchorage; we have satellite offices in Fairbanks and Juneau, and our attorneys travel on a regular basis.
